What Are Surety Contract Bonds?
Surety Contract bonds are a kind of monetary warranty that gives assurance to task owners that service providers will certainly accomplish their legal commitments. These bonds function as a type of protection for the job owner by making certain that the specialist will complete the job as set, or compensate for any kind of economic loss incurred.
When a service provider acquires a guaranty bond, they're basically becoming part of a legally binding contract with a guaranty firm. This arrangement mentions that the specialist will satisfy their responsibilities and satisfy all contractual requirements. If the specialist stops working to do so, the guaranty business will certainly step in and offer the necessary funds to finish the project or compensate the task owner for any problems.
By doing this, Surety Contract bonds supply assurance to task proprietors and minimize the risks related to working with service providers.
